Ericsson appoints Head of Business Unit Modems

Ericsson has appointed Mats Norin as Vice President and Head of Business Unit Modems.  He will also take a seat on Ericsson’s Global Leadership Team, reporting to Chairman of Business Unit Modems and Head of Group Function Strategy, Douglas Gilstrap.



Business Unit Modems includes the design, development, supply and sales of the LTE multimode thin modem solutions, including 2G, 3G and 4G interoperability. On August 2, 2013, this activity was transferred to Ericsson from ST-Ericsson where Norin served as Executive Vice President and Chief Technology Officer since 2012.
